Methods to assess vitamin D status in pregnant women
Assessing vitamin D status in pregnant women is crucial to determine their levels of this important nutrient during pregnancy. There are various methods that can be used to assess vitamin D status, each with its advantages and limitations.
1. Serum 25-hydroxyvitamin D [25(OH)D] levels
The most common method used to assess vitamin D status is measuring the levels of serum 25-hydroxyvitamin D [25(OH)D]. This is the major circulating form of vitamin D and reflects the body’s overall vitamin D status. A blood sample is taken from pregnant women, and the concentration of 25(OH)D is measured using laboratory techniques.
2. Dietary intake assessment
Assessing the dietary intake of vitamin D can also provide an estimation of the vitamin D status in pregnant women. This method involves collecting information about the foods and drinks consumed by pregnant women and calculating the amount of vitamin D ingested from these sources. However, it should be noted that dietary assessment may not accurately reflect the actual vitamin D status, as there may be variations in absorption and metabolism of vitamin D in individuals.
3. Sunlight exposure assessment
Sunlight exposure is an important source of vitamin D synthesis in the body. Assessing the amount of sunlight exposure can provide some insights into the vitamin D status of pregnant women. This can be done by questionnaires or using devices that measure sun exposure. However, it should be noted that other factors, such as sunscreen use and clothing choices, can affect the amount of vitamin D synthesis from sunlight exposure.
4. Other biomarkers
There are other biomarkers that can be used to assess vitamin D status in pregnant women. These include parathyroid hormone (PTH) levels and bone mineral density measurements. However, these biomarkers are less specific to vitamin D status and may not provide a comprehensive assessment.
Overall, a combination of different methods is recommended to assess vitamin D status in pregnant women, as each method has its limitations. Serum 25(OH)D levels are considered the gold standard, but incorporating dietary intake assessment and sunlight exposure assessment can provide a more comprehensive understanding of vitamin D status during pregnancy.

Factors influencing vitamin D levels during pregnancy
During pregnancy, the levels of vitamin D in women are influenced by various factors. These factors can affect the maternal vitamin D status and ultimately the health of the developing fetus.
1. Sun exposure: Sunlight is a major source of vitamin D. Women who spend more time outdoors and expose their skin to the sun are more likely to have higher vitamin D levels. However, factors such as geography, season, and cultural practices can affect the amount of sunlight exposure.
2. Dietary intake: Vitamin D is found in certain foods, including fatty fish, fortified dairy products, and eggs. The dietary intake of vitamin D can significantly impact the vitamin D levels in pregnant women. Poor dietary habits or restricted diets may lead to vitamin D deficiency.
3. Body mass index (BMI): Obesity is associated with lower vitamin D levels. This is because vitamin D is stored in adipose tissue, and higher body fat can trap vitamin D, making it less available for use. Pregnant women with a higher BMI may have lower vitamin D levels.
4. Skin color: Melanin is the pigment that gives color to the skin. It also acts as a natural sunblock, which means that individuals with darker skin require more sun exposure to produce the same amount of vitamin D as individuals with lighter skin. Women with darker skin may have lower vitamin D levels during pregnancy.
5. Gestational age: Vitamin D levels may fluctuate during different stages of pregnancy. Some studies have shown that vitamin D levels tend to decrease as pregnancy progresses, while others have found no significant changes. The exact reason for these fluctuations is not yet fully understood.
6. Multivitamin use: Pregnant women often take multivitamin supplements, which may contain vitamin D. Regular use of these supplements can help maintain optimal vitamin D levels during pregnancy. However, it is important to consult a healthcare provider for appropriate dosage and formulation.
7. Medical conditions: Certain medical conditions, such as liver and kidney diseases, can affect the body’s ability to synthesize and metabolize vitamin D. Pregnant women with these conditions may have lower vitamin D levels and require additional monitoring and supplementation.
In conclusion, the vitamin D levels during pregnancy are influenced by several factors, including sun exposure, dietary intake, BMI, skin color, gestational age, multivitamin use, and underlying medical conditions. Maintaining adequate vitamin D levels is crucial for the overall health of both the mother and the developing fetus.

Role of sunlight exposure in maintaining vitamin D levels during pregnancy
During pregnancy, it is crucial for women to maintain optimal vitamin D levels in order to support the healthy development of the fetus and prevent complications. Sunlight exposure plays a significant role in maintaining adequate vitamin D levels in pregnant women.
Vitamin D is naturally synthesized in the skin when it is exposed to the ultraviolet B (UVB) rays of the sun. These UVB rays convert 7-dehydrocholesterol in the skin into previtamin D3, which is then converted into active vitamin D3. Therefore, exposure to sunlight is the primary source of vitamin D for most individuals, including pregnant women.
Maternal vitamin D levels during pregnancy have a direct impact on the vitamin D status of the fetus. Insufficient levels of vitamin D during pregnancy have been linked to an increased risk of gestational diabetes, preeclampsia, preterm birth, and low birth weight. Additionally, it has been associated with an increased risk of childhood asthma and allergic diseases.

Vitamin D and gestational diabetes
Gestational diabetes is a condition that occurs during pregnancy and is characterized by high blood sugar levels. It can have negative effects on both maternal and fetal health.
Research has shown a potential link between vitamin D deficiency and an increased risk of developing gestational diabetes. Studies have found that pregnant women with low vitamin D levels are more likely to develop gestational diabetes compared to those with sufficient levels of vitamin D.
Vitamin D plays a crucial role in the regulation of blood sugar levels and insulin production. It is involved in the synthesis of insulin and enhances insulin sensitivity in the body. Therefore, maintaining adequate vitamin D levels during pregnancy may help reduce the risk of gestational diabetes.
It is recommended that pregnant women regularly monitor their vitamin D status and ensure they are receiving adequate levels of this essential nutrient. This can be achieved through a combination of sunlight exposure, diet, and supplementation if necessary.
In conclusion, maintaining optimal vitamin D levels during pregnancy is important in reducing the risk of gestational diabetes. Pregnant women should pay attention to their vitamin D status and take necessary steps to ensure they are meeting their nutritional needs.
Vitamin D and preeclampsia
During pregnancy, women require adequate levels of vitamin D to support fetal development and maintain their own health. Maternal vitamin D levels play a crucial role in various aspects of pregnancy, including the prevention of preeclampsia.
Preeclampsia is a pregnancy complication that is characterized by high blood pressure and damage to organs, most commonly the liver and kidneys. It can lead to serious complications for both the mother and the baby. Studies have shown that vitamin D deficiency during pregnancy increases the risk of developing preeclampsia.
Vitamin D has several mechanisms that help protect against preeclampsia. It regulates blood pressure by promoting the synthesis of nitric oxide, a molecule that helps relax blood vessels. It also plays a role in inflammation and immune function, both of which are important in the development of preeclampsia.
Research suggests that maintaining optimal vitamin D status in pregnant women may reduce the risk of preeclampsia. The recommended daily intake of vitamin D for pregnant women is 600-800 IU (international units). However, individual needs may vary, and it is important for pregnant women to consult with their healthcare provider to determine the appropriate dosage.
In conclusion, adequate vitamin D levels during pregnancy are important for the prevention of preeclampsia. Pregnant women should ensure they have sufficient vitamin D intake and regularly monitor their vitamin D status to promote a healthy pregnancy and reduce the risk of complications.
